Just to finish out this thread, I can report that we successfully
got two USB QuickCam Orbits to function on the same computer,
sending the video to two different windows.  We were able to
get full 30 Hz frame rates by first adding another PCI USB card to
our upgraded 8500, then shrinking the capture window somewhat,
for example 180 x 240 in 16 bit color seems to work fine.  This
resolution is plenty for our purposes.  We are assembling the two
images side by side, then sending them out the video port of the 8500,
where another machine will do the disparity calculations on the
stereo pair.  In addition, we have simultaneous motor control
of the Orbits.

This is all under OS 9, apparently this can't (yet?) be done in OS X,
and can't be done with firewire cameras in either operating system.
There are mysteries, such as some dreaded Type 10 errors when the
windows become large enough to drop the frame rate below 30 Hz.
Also, the quickcams sometimes have to be plugged in in the right
order to get both images to appear, and the computer sometimes
has to be sprinkled with holy water.

But all in all, pretty impressive behavior for a driver that has
never been tested in this configuration!
